In a series of recent social media posts, singer Jelena Karleusa — as Us Weekly notes, otherwise known as the "Gaga of Serbia — called out Kim Kardashian for copying her aesthetic. That's a glam, pouty, bleached blonde, and skintight monochrome look specifically; very similar to the one Kim's been showing off all over Paris Fashion Week.

"Lets play a game-FIND ME!," Karleusa captioned the collage above, and it's maybe not quite as easy as it first looks; of course, there's no copyright on a bottle of peroxide and a pile of sheer black separates either.But the likeness really is legit, as further photo comparisons illustrate:

Karleusa told Us Weekly she believes the similarity is because "[Kim's] stylists are inspired by my Instagram page," though no-one from Kim's camp has (yet) commented on the allegation. Oh, and just for good measure, Karleusa added that she doesn't have a stylist herself. She's not blaming anyone though, adding the hashtag #Illtakeitasacompliment to one photo.
